The Jazzschool Studio Band, comprised of many of the finest high school musicians in the Bay Area, is a part of the Community Music School, a division of the California Jazz Conservatory in Berkeley, California. Students develop technique, knowledge of jazz style, and an ability to improvise through standard and contemporary big band repertoire. This ensemble performs frequently and participates in competitions throughout the U.S. Over the years, Jazzschool Studio Band has played at the Freight, Yoshi’s, the CJC, Savanna Jazz, and jazz festivals in California, New York, Seattle, Idaho, the Vienne Jazz Festival in France, the Montreux Jazz Festival, in Switzerland and the Umbria Jazz Festival in Perugia, Italy. The group has performed regularly at the Monterey Jazz Festival’s Next Generation national competition and won multiple Student Music Awards from downbeat magazine.
